Washington Hawthorne

Crataegus phaenopyrum

Be the first to review this product


Product Description

Small tree or large shrub with slender branches and narrow thorns. Finely cut, green leaves turn scarlet red in autumn. Clusters of small, white flowers in late spring are followed by bright red berries that persist into winter.
Hardy to -40°F
Maximum Elevation: 7,000 ft.

SKU HAW-WAS
Deciduous Tree Type Flowering Tree
Tree Habit Spreading, Oval
Mature Size (generic) TREE (20-30' Tall) • Average WIdth
Fall Color Dramatic
Features Showy Flowers
Flowering Season Spring
USDA Hardiness Zone 3, 4, 5, 6, 7
Water Needs Moderate
Growth Rate Moderate
Light Needs Full Sun
Mature Height 20-30 ft.
Mature Width 15-25 ft.
Name Washington Hawthorne
